Product Description
HX55 4038616D serves Scania 4-series 124 truck and bus applications using DSC12 or DC12 engines. The catalog also lists Garrett 703072-5003S, but that number belongs to a separate GT4288 complete-turbo family and does not confirm cartridge interchangeability with Holset housings. Buyers should match the removed manufacturer label, OE 1538372, 1538373, or 1423040, engine rating, and wheel dimensions. Manufacturer-specific stock is essential for long-service Scania fleets with previous turbo replacements.

Garrett 703072-5003S identifies a GT4288 complete turbo used in related Scania 124 applications. Holset HX55 4038616D uses another cartridge and housing design. A complete-unit cross reference may help application research, but internal cores should follow the manufacturer and removed turbo nameplate. A truck or bus may have received a complete Garrett alternative, a Holset reman unit, or mixed service components during decades of operation. The current turbo may therefore differ from the original chassis catalog. Workshops should photograph the installed nameplate and housings before ordering instead of relying only on registration or engine family. A number-led record gives repeat buyers a safer basis than a broad machine or engine description.
Hot oil pressure, feed-pipe condition, drain routing, crankcase ventilation, filter history, and oil contamination should be checked. Long-service engines can carry coking or wear that damages a replacement core. The charge-air cooler should also be cleaned when the prior compressor released oil or metal. Repair is useful when the Holset housings remain sound and the cartridge identity is confirmed, especially where complete turbos are costly or inconsistent to catalog record. A complete unit is safer when housings are cracked, mixed, or heavily machined. Workshop capability and vehicle downtime should guide the decision.
